If you are planning to import cashew nuts from Vietnam, one of the first decisions you will face is whether to work directly with a factory or buy through a trading company.
Many buyers assume buying directly from a factory always means lower prices and better results. In reality, the best option depends on your order size, product requirements, logistics experience, and sourcing goals.
This guide explains the differences between Vietnamese cashew processing factories and trading companies so you can make a more informed decision before contacting suppliers.
What Is a Cashew Processing Factory?
A cashew processing factory is a company that receives raw cashew nuts and processes them into export-ready products.
Depending on the facility, processing may include:
-
Shelling and peeling
-
Drying and moisture control
-
Sorting by grade
-
Roasting or seasoning
-
Packaging for export
-
Quality inspection and documentation
Factories usually specialize in production efficiency and consistent output.
Some factories export under their own brand, while others operate mainly as OEM or bulk suppliers.
Working directly with a factory can provide more control over specifications, but it may also require larger order commitments.
What Is a Cashew Trading Company?
A trading company purchases products from factories and supplies them to domestic or international buyers.
Instead of manufacturing products themselves, traders focus on:
-
Supplier coordination
-
Product sourcing
-
Order consolidation
-
Export paperwork
-
Communication support
-
Logistics management
Some trading companies work with multiple factories and can offer buyers more flexibility.
For importers who are new to Vietnam or do not want to manage several suppliers, traders may simplify the process.
Factory vs Trading Company: Key Differences
| Factor | Factory | Trading Company |
|---|---|---|
| Product source | Own production | Multiple factories |
| MOQ | Often higher | Usually more flexible |
| Pricing | Potentially lower | Includes service margin |
| Customization | Strong | Depends on factory network |
| Lead time | Production schedule dependent | Sometimes faster |
| Communication | Direct | Managed by intermediary |
| Product variety | Limited to capability | Broader |
| Supply flexibility | Moderate | Higher |
These differences are not absolute.
A professional trading company may outperform an inexperienced factory in communication, delivery reliability, or product matching.
When Buying Directly from a Factory Makes Sense
Working directly with a factory may be suitable if:
-
You already import agricultural products regularly
-
You need consistent long-term supply
-
Your order volumes are relatively large
-
You require private label or custom specifications
-
You have experience managing quality control
Factory sourcing can reduce layers in the supply chain, but buyers often need stronger verification and coordination processes.
When a Trading Company May Be the Better Choice
A trading company can be useful when:
-
You are sourcing from Vietnam for the first time
-
You want lower initial order quantities
-
You need multiple cashew grades
-
You prefer communication support
-
You want faster supplier screening
For many small and medium buyers, reducing sourcing complexity can matter more than achieving the lowest possible unit price.
5 Questions Buyers Should Ask Before Choosing
Before deciding, consider asking suppliers these questions:
1. Are you a factory, a trading company, or both?
Some businesses operate hybrid models.
2. What cashew grades do you regularly export?
Ask whether supply is stable throughout the year.
3. What is your typical MOQ?
Minimum order quantity affects supplier fit more than price alone.
4. Can you provide export documentation examples?
Documents help reveal operational maturity.
5. How do you handle quality issues?
Understand their process before placing orders.
